Buff FA
« on: October 09, 2012, 02:17:14 pm »

Superstims have taken the role of first aid. Some use it for leveling and in the beginning but that's just a fraction how players heal up and has nothing to do with later gameplay.

Do this:
- Merge doc and FA
- Get rid of cooldown. Shooting has no cooldown either, it consumes action points.
- Make the skill work so that when used, it spends all your action points and heals an amount of hps dependent on the action points spent and skill%. So you can use it even with 1 ap.
- It can cure cripples. But it has a chance based on skill% and aps spent. Have it so that after 4 full action point pools consumed, a cripple is guaranteed to heal. That means that if you have 10 aps and low FA, after spending 40 aps the cripple is guaranteed to be mended. But there's always a chance to heal at first time. So basically: after 20 seconds you won't be crippled anymore. 
- Make it so that you can wake up knocked out players with FA. High skill increases the amount of aps restored.

Some of these could require a medic-item like doctor's bag to work so that you wouldn't get too much benefit without risking any gear.
